Asus EN8800GTS - Product Specifications & Features

Graphics Engine
GeForce 8800GTS
Video Memory
320MB DDR3
Engine Clock
500MHz
Memory Clock
1.6GHz (800MHz DDR3)
Memory Interface
320-bit
Max Resolution
Up to 2560 x 1600
VGA Output
YES, via DVI to VGA Adapter
HDTV Output
YES, via HDTV Out cable
TV Output
YES, via S-Video to Composite
DVI Output
DVI-I
Dual DVI Output
YES
HDCP Support
YES
Adaptor/Cable bundled
DVI to VGA adapter
Power Cable
HDTV-out cable
Software Bundled
3D Game: Ghost Recon, GTI Racing
3Dmark06
ASUS Utilities & Driver
2nd VGA Output
Card Size: 9 inch length, 4.97 inch width, 1.43 inch height
6 pin power connector * 1 inside the box
Minimum 400W or greater system power supply (with 12V current rating of 26A)

Available Models: GeForce 8800 GTX and GeForce 8800 GTS 

GeForce 8800 GTX    GeForce 8800 GTX
Stream Processors 128 96
Core Clock (MHz) 575 500
Shader Clock (MHz) 1350 1200
Memory Clock (MHz) 900 800
Memory Amount 768MB 640MB or 320MB
Memory Interface 384-bit 320-bit
Memory Bandwidth (GB/sec) 86.4 64
Texture Fill Rate (billion/sec) 36.8 24

NVIDIA® PureVideo™ HD Technology2:
The combination of high-definition video decode acceleration and post-processing that delivers unprecedented picture clarity, smooth video, accurate color, and precise image scaling for movies and video.

    Discrete, Programmable Video Processor:
    NVIDIA PureVideo is a discrete programmable processing core in NVIDIA GPUs that provides superb picture quality and ultra-smooth movies with low CPU utilization and power.

    Hardware Decode Acceleration:
    Provides ultra-smooth playback of H.264, VC-1, WMV and MPEG-2 HD and SD movies.

    HDCP Capable3:
    Designed to meet the output protection management (HDCP) and security specifications of the Blu-ray Disc and HD DVD formats, allowing the playback of encrypted movie content on PCs when connected to HDCP-compliant displays.

    Spatial-Temporal De-Interlacing:
    Sharpens HD and standard definition interlaced content on progressive displays, delivering a crisp, clear picture that rivals high-end home-theater systems.

    High-Quality Scaling:
    Enlarges lower resolution movies and videos to HDTV resolutions, up to 1080i, while maintaining a clear, clean image. Also provides downscaling of videos, including high-definition, while preserving image detail.

    Inverse Telecine (3:2 & 2:2 Pulldown Correction):
    Recovers original film images from films-converted-to-video, providing more accurate movie playback and superior picture quality.

    Bad Edit Correction:
    When videos are edited after they have been converted from 24 to 25 or 30 frames, the edits can disrupt the normal 3:2 or 2:2 pulldown cadence. PureVideo uses advanced processing techniques to detect poor edits, recover the original content, and display perfect picture detail frame after frame for smooth, natural looking video.

    Noise Reduction:
    Improves movie image quality by removing unwanted artifacts.

    Edge Enhancement:
    Sharpens movie images by providing higher contrast around lines and objects.
